Cost of the immobilizer
peugeot key code's immobilizer has proven successful in protecting against car thefts by making it difficult to connect the car to a hot wire or employ traditional methods like hammering the ignition to force it to start. The immobilizer sends signals to the computer in the car with a tiny piece of glass that is hidden inside the key. The computer is able to check for the correct signal and, if present, the engine begins. In case it's not the fuel supply will be shut off. If you are unable to turn on your vehicle, the chip may be defective or lost its programming. To fix the issue you should contact an auto locksmith or auto shop.
